I am going to take the opposite view and say that perhaps it is more they didn't want to just put out any old thing so they are waiting for the muse. I think they still have a passion for music as a band but perhaps they are just not happy with what they've been conjuring up and that's what is taking so long. They may also have fragments of ideas they think are good and they are letting them gestate so when they reconvene they bring something new to add to a song, or come up with better ideas on where the fragments go.
I also think Mike McCready sounds like he's talking about just about any Pearl Jam album out there - actually sounds like he is talking about Binaural, which I've always seen as a logical follow up to Yield with a more experimental Pink Floyd-ish vibe ("Nothing As It Seems") and punk rock songs ("Grievance").
I am quite agitated by the length of time it is taking - and sadly the longer it takes the more pressure there is to deliver. This next album will likely cement in many fans' head where this band is going from here on - will they be a nostalgic band relying on past glory coming around every half decade to present us with decent, but ultimately unmemorable songs (a la Rolling Stones in the last quarter of their career), or will they bring a newfound relevance to us and create career defining sounds once again (a la Bruce Springsteen The Rising, Magic, Wrecking Ball)? Sadly, once you've been around long enough, you end up in one of those categories.
